There is, … WebJul 12, 2024 · Chloroplast photosystems generate ATP and NADPH during photosynthesis. To fix one CO 2 molecule, three ATP molecules and two NADPH molecules (ATP/NADPH = 1.5) are consumed by the Calvin-Benson-Bassham (CBB) cycle (Fig. 1 B).
